Abstract

The utility model discloses an anti-fracture needle-type electric knife pen, which comprises a contraction conversion device, wherein the contraction conversion device is sequentially provided with a main body part, a first contraction section and a second contraction section from left to right; the shrinkage conversion device is axially provided with a mounting hole, and the left side of the mounting hole is provided with a conductive pen core; a lock nut for locking the silver needle is arranged at the contraction section formed by the first contraction section and the second contraction section; the main body part is provided with a handle shell. The utility model has the advantages that: 1. the steel needle head is replaced by the silver needle head, so that on one hand, the silver needle head has high ductility and cannot be easily broken. 2. Adopt the flexible glue to replace plastics to make the handle shell, improved the holistic shock-absorbing capacity of electrotome pen, avoided the electrotome pen to fall behind, the condition of inner structure damage takes place. 3. The lock nut is matched with the first contraction section and the second contraction section, so that the needle head replacement function of the electric knife pen is increased, and resources are saved.

Background
The electric knife pen is an electric surgical device for replacing a mechanical scalpel to cut tissues, and is widely applied to surgical operations. The high-frequency high-voltage current generated by the head of the effective electrode heats the tissue when contacting with the human body, so that the tissue of the human body is separated and coagulated, and the cutting and hemostasis purposes are achieved. Has the advantages of rapid hemostasis, less bleeding, bacterial infection prevention, good postoperative healing of patients and the like.
The existing needle-type electric knife pen is mostly disposable, and can be directly discarded after being used, thereby causing resource waste; the needle head of the disposable electric knife pen is mostly a steel needle, so that the steel needle is easy to break under the conduction of high-frequency current; the shell of the disposable electric knife pen is made of plastic, so that the shock absorption effect is poor under the condition of falling, and the internal structure is easily damaged.

Example (b):
as shown in fig. 1 and 2, an anti-fracture needle-type electric knife pen includes a contraction conversion device 2, wherein the contraction conversion device 2 has a main body portion 21, a first contraction section 22 and a second contraction section 23 in sequence from left to right; the shrinkage conversion device 2 is axially provided with a mounting hole, and the left side of the mounting hole is provided with a conductive pen core 3; an electrode 5 is arranged at the left end of the contraction conversion device 2, one side of the electrode 5 is connected with the left end of the conductive pen core 3, the other side of the electrode 5 is connected with a lead 9, a switch 10 is arranged on the lead, and a connecting sheet 7 is arranged in the mounting hole and positioned at the right end of the conductive pen core 3; the right side of the mounting hole is provided with a silver needle 4, the left end of the silver needle 4 is connected with a connecting sheet 7, and the right end of the silver needle 4 extends out of the mounting hole to form an extending part; a lock nut 8 for locking the silver needle 4 is arranged at the contraction section formed by the first contraction section 22 and the second contraction section 23; the handle case 1 is attached to the main body 21.
The handle shell 1 is fixedly sleeved on the outer surface of the main body part 2; the middle of the handle shell 1 is provided with a smooth section for holding, and two sides of the smooth section are respectively provided with a connecting section with external threads.
The connecting sheet 7 is fixedly arranged in the mounting hole, and on one hand, the connecting sheet 7 can cut off the positions of the conductive pen core 3 and the silver needle 4, so that the silver needle 4 can be detachably arranged; and on the other hand, the conductive pen core 3 is used for conducting the current to the silver needle 4.
A lock nut 8 for locking the silver needle 4 is arranged at the contraction section formed by the first contraction section 22 and the second contraction section 23; the lock nut 8 is divided into two parts, one part has a larger inner diameter, and the inside of the part is provided with a thread meshed with the external thread of the first contraction section 22; the other part has a smaller inner diameter for fastening the bifurcated second necked portion 23; by screwing the lock nut 8, the part with the larger inner diameter of the lock nut 8 moves leftwards on the first contraction section 22, and the part with the smaller inner diameter of the lock nut 8 tightly closes the forked clamping section 25, so that the silver needle 4 cannot slide back and forth in the mounting hole.
The left side of the handle shell 1 is provided with an insulated rear pen cap 12, and the right side is provided with an insulated front pen cap 11. The insulating rear pen cap 12 is provided with a small hole through which the lead 9 passes; the insulating rear pen cap 12 is in threaded engagement with the connecting section on the left side of the handle shell 1; through the arrangement of the insulating rear pen cap 12, the connection condition of the lead 9 and the electrode 5 can be conveniently checked, and the electrode 5 is convenient to replace. The insulating front pen cap 11 is in threaded engagement with the connecting section on the right side of the handle shell 1; the purpose is to protect the needle head of the silver needle 4 under the condition of not using the electric knife pen.
The handle shell 1 is integrally made of soft rubber. The flexible glue is a soft damping material, can improve the anti-falling capability of the electric knife pen, and avoids the damage of the internal components of the electric knife pen caused by falling.
The extension part of the silver needle 4 is also wrapped with a latex tube 6. The soft rubber tube 6 is wrapped on the extension part of the silver needle 4, so that the side surface of the silver needle 4 is prevented from being scalded to the skin in the operation.
The outer surfaces of the two ends of the main body part 21 and the outer surface of the lock nut 8 are also provided with anti-skid grains. When the main body part 21 is wrapped by the handle shell 1, two ends of the main body part 21 extend out of the handle shell 1; the anti-slip grains are arranged on the part, extending out of the main body part 21, so that the hand-held electric tool is convenient to hold; the outer surface of the locking nut 8 is provided with anti-slip threads, so that the locking nut 8 can be used conveniently.
The working process of the electric knife pen comprises the following steps: and (3) removing the power supply, opening the insulated pen cap 12, checking whether the lead 9 is normally connected with the electrode 5, and tightly covering the insulated pen cap 12 after normal. Open insulating preceding pen socket 11, then unscrew lock nut 8, take out original silver needle 4 from the mounting hole, replace new silver needle 4, rethread installation lock nut 8 for the great part of lock nut 8 internal diameter moves left at first shrink section 22, and the less part of lock nut 8 internal diameter is with the part A of the bifurcation of second shrink section 23 sticiss, makes silver needle 4 can not make a round trip to slide in the mounting hole. The extension part of the silver needle 4 is sleeved with the latex tube 13, so that only the needle tip of the silver needle 4 is exposed outside; the power is then turned on, the switch 10 is opened and the use of the pencil is started.
After the electric knife pen is used, the switch 10 is closed, the power supply is pulled out, and the insulating front pen cap 11 is in threaded engagement with the connecting section on the left side of the handle shell 1, so that the electric knife pen is protected.
